Modern tennis balls must conform to certain criteria for size, weight, deformation, and bounce criteria to be approved for regulation play. The International Tennis Federation (ITF) defines the official diameter as 6.54–6.86 cm (2.57–2.70 inches). Balls must have masses in the range 56.0–59.4 g (1.98–2.10 … See more A tennis ball is a ball designed for the sport of tennis. Tennis balls are fluorescent yellow in organised competitions, but in recreational play can be virtually any color. Web26 May 2024 · The size of the ball changed from 38mm to 40mm in 2000 October 1st. So you should buy a table tennis ball writing 40 or 40+ on it. The reason behind this decision is to slow down the game and improve visibility. The improvement in racket production technology and speed glue had increased the speed of the game.
